| Obverse description | King Peter I enthroned facing, depicted in full regalia, holding an upright sword in his right hand and an orb or sceptre in his left; a shield bearing the arms of Cyprus (a lion rampant) is displayed to the lower right of the throne. The figure is rendered in the Gothic style typical of Lusignan coinage. The entire design is enclosed within a beaded inner circle, with the royal Latin legend arranged around the periphery. |
